Regions :: Western Europe :: U.K. U.K. Industry Welcomes Sustainability Discussion Plans, Still Harbors Concerns4:18 AM MDT | August 8, 2011 | Alex Scott Steve Elliott, CEO of industry body the Chemical Industries Association (CIA; London), has welcomed the U.K. government’s paper on plans for transitioning to a green economy. The report, which was published at the end of the past week, cites the need for dialogue between government, business and communities as the U.K. economy transitions to a green economy.
